Description

An open house was held January 25, 1968 at Jacksonville State University's newly built Martin Science Hall. President Dr. and Mrs. Houston Cole received students, faculty, and visitors at the informal open house. Shown guests are enjoying refreshments being served in the astronomical observatory and planetarium on the third floor.
